Shed Base Concrete Slab Calculator

A concrete slab is the gold-standard shed foundation: rot-proof, level, and rated for real weight. The math mistake people make is ordering by area instead of volume โ€” thickness changes everything. Enter your shed footprint and slab thickness to get cubic yards for a ready-mix order, or bag counts for smaller pads.

How this calculator works

Volume = length ร— width ร— thickness, converted to cubic yards (รท27) with 10% waste added for uneven subgrade. A 10ร—12 shed slab at 4" thick needs about 1.5 cubic yards โ€” that's ready-mix territory (about 68 bags of 80 lb, which nobody should hand-mix). The calculator flags when your pour crosses the ready-mix threshold.

How much concrete do I need for a 10x12 shed slab?

At the standard 4" thickness: 10 ร— 12 ร— 0.333 ft = 40 cu ft โ‰ˆ 1.5 cubic yards with waste. As bags that's ~68 ร— 80 lb โ€” impractical by hand. Order ready-mix, or step down to a gravel foundation if delivery access is a problem.

How thick should a shed slab be?

4 inches handles nearly every garden shed and workshop. Go 5โ€“6" if you'll park a ride-on mower, car, or heavy machinery on it, and thicken the edges to 8โ€“12" if your area requires a monolithic footing.

Do I need rebar or mesh in a shed slab?

For a 4" residential shed slab, 6ร—6 welded wire mesh or fiber-reinforced mix is typical and adequate. Rebar (#3 or #4 on a grid) is worth it for 5"+ slabs, vehicle loads, or questionable soil. What matters just as much: a compacted 4" gravel base under the pour.
